In short, in systemd 237 as it ships with Bionic, if a unit has a drop-
in present but has been masked, systemctl is-enabled and systemctl list-
unit-files report incorrect state, showing the units as enabled rather
than masked.
This works as-expected in systemd 229 under Xenial. I have not tested
under systemd 234 in artful so I cannot say for sure exactly when this
was introduced, but will spin up a quick test to see if this also exists
under systemd 234.
